Sonali Bank Partners with Islami Bank For Online Fee Collection

Industry: Bank, Financial
Company: Islami Bank Bangladesh Limited (IBBL), Sonali Bank Limited
Company Intelligence Tag: Partnership Insights

Sonali Bank PLC, one of the largest state-owned banks in Bangladesh, has signed an agreement with Islami Bank Bangladesh Limited to enable the collection of fees and charges from customers of Islami Bank’s digital wallet service ‘Cellfin’ and mobile financial service ‘Mcash’ through Sonali Bank’s payment gateway. The deal allows the 2.7 million Cellfin customers and 0.8 million Mcash customers to conveniently make online payments for various fees and charges while staying at home. The signing ceremony took place at Sonali Bank’s head office, with top executives from both banks in attendance.

Social Islami Bank Waives Late Fees for Credit Card Installments

July 27, 2024

Social Islami Bank announced that customers unable to pay their investment and credit card installments on time due to the ongoing situation can now do so without incurring late fees until the end of July 2024. All ATMs of the bank are fully operational. Additionally, customers who have not previously used or taken debit cards can now easily obtain them from any branch and conduct transactions accordingly, as stated in a press release.

BB Lends Tk 25,521 Crore to Banks and NBFIs in One Day

July 27, 2024

According to a press release from the Bangladesh Bank (BB), BB supplied 25,521 crore TK (or 255 billion TK) in a single day to banks and non-banking financial institutions (NBFIs) as borrowings. Shariah-based banks borrowed 1,500 crore TK, with the remainder taken by other banks and institutions.

Shahjalal Islami Bank Reports Tk 167 Crore Profit

July 27, 2024

Shahjalal Islami Bank reported a profit of Tk 167.05 crore for the April-June quarter of 2024, a marginal increase from Tk 166.79 crore during the same period last year. For the first half of 2024, the bank's profit rose 5% year-on-year to Tk 288.86 crore. Consolidated earnings per share (EPS) improved to Tk 2.59 from Tk 2.45, and net operating cash flow per share (NOCFPS) surged to Tk 12.48 from Tk 6.48.

AB Bank Re-Elects Barrister Khairul Alam Choudhury as Chairman

July 27, 2024

Barrister Khairul Alam Choudhury has been re-elected as Chairman of AB Bank for a second consecutive term. A senior Supreme Court lawyer, he graduated from the University of Wolverhampton in 2001 and completed his post-graduation from City University in 2002. He was also called to the Bar at Lincoln’s Inn, London. Barrister Choudhury is actively involved in various social and charitable activities.

IFIC Bank Launches IFIC Islamic Banking Services

July 27, 2024

IFIC Bank has launched "IFIC Islamic," a comprehensive range of Shariah-compliant banking services, alongside its traditional offerings. The service, inaugurated by Salman F Rahman, the prime minister's adviser on private industry, is now available across over 1,400 IFIC Bank branches and sub-branches. The launch event was attended by Md Khurshid Alam, Deputy Governor of Bangladesh Bank, and other key figures including the bank's managing director and Shariah Supervisory Committee chairman.

Commercial Banks’ Foreign Exchange Hits $6.10 Billion

July 27, 2024

As of June 2034, foreign exchange holdings in Bangladesh's commercial banks surged to a record high, primarily due to rising remittance receipts and lower import payments, alongside new incentives. The increase provides relief to the economy, which has faced significant challenges from dwindling forex reserves. The recently enacted Offshore Banking Act 2024, which offers attractive terms such as 9% interest and flexible withdrawals, has also contributed to this boost.
